What is a 6-Foot Container?
A 6-foot container is commonly used for storage and transport. Its dimensions normally determine around 72 inches in length, 56 inches in width, and 78 inches in height (1.8 m x 1.4 m x 2.0 m). In spite of its moderate size, a 6-foot container offers a considerable quantity of adaptability and energy.

The applications for 6-foot containers are large. Here are a few of the more significant usages:

Residential Storage: Ideal for homeowners needing additional space for seasonal products, tools, or sports devices.

Business Applications: Businesses can use 6-foot containers for additional storage on-site, developing a makeshift office, or perhaps as pop-up retail areas.

Event Management: Organizers can utilize these containers to shop equipment, materials, or product at celebrations, performances, or sporting occasions.

Construction Sites: The compact size makes it simpler to transport and position on job sites where space is limited.

Benefits of Using 6-Foot Containers
Before settling on a storage option, it's vital to weigh the benefits of 6-foot containers:

Space Efficiency: Their workable size makes them ideal for locations where bigger containers can not fit.

Portability: They can easily be moved to various locations, making them ideal for vibrant environments.

Resilience: Made from robust products, 6-foot containers can endure extreme weather, securing their contents.

Security: Lockable doors make sure that products stored inside are safe from theft or vandalism.

Versatile Modifications: They can be customized for numerous functions, such as adding windows, vents, or shelving.

Cost-Effectiveness: Compared to bigger storage alternatives, they provide a more cost effective service without compromising functionality.
Drawbacks of 6-Foot Containers
While there are numerous advantages, some downsides are related to 6-foot containers that prospective users must think about:

Limited Space: The compact size may not be suitable for larger storage requirements.

Transportation Challenges: While portable, moving a container may require special equipment depending upon its placement location.

Ventilation Issues: 6ft shipping containers can end up being hot and unventilated, which might harm sensitive products unless properly modified.

Zoning Restrictions: Local regulations might govern where and how containers can be put, particularly in suburbs.
